for循環(huán)雞兔同籠編程 C語言編程雞兔同籠怎么寫代碼?
C語言編程雞兔同籠怎么寫代碼?#這是一個(gè)整數(shù),可以用來輸入&printd(]%F”、&printd(]%F”,雞爪總數(shù)(]%d)只能用&printd(]%F”)來計(jì)算,它可以用來輸入{F]!“)返回0
C語言編程雞兔同籠怎么寫代碼?
#這是一個(gè)整數(shù),可以用來輸入&printd(]%F
”、&printd(]%F
”,雞爪總數(shù)(]%d)只能用&printd(]%F
”)來計(jì)算,它可以用來輸入{F
]!“)
返回0
}]C=(4*a-b)/2//雞的數(shù)量
d=a-C//兔子的數(shù)量
如果(C*2 d*4==b)printf(“有%LD只雞n有%LD只兔子”,C,d)
else printf
int main(){int a,B對(duì)于(a=1A<25a)//兔子的數(shù)量從1到24{B=40-a//雞的數(shù)量等于40減去兔子的數(shù)量如果(4*a 2*B==100)//兔子和雞的腳的總數(shù)等于100 Printf(“有%d只兔子和%d只雞”,a,b) //打印滿足條件的兔子和雞的數(shù)量}返回0}
private sub command1_uu2;Click()
dim a,b,m,n as integer“雞是a,兔子是b,雞和兔子的總數(shù)是m,雞和兔子的腳數(shù)是n
對(duì)于b=1到m
a=m-b
如果2*a 4*b=n,則打印
”“chicken=”& A&“,rabbit=”& b
end if
next b
end sub
]A.b,C,D
printf(“這是一個(gè)小程序,用于計(jì)算同一籠子中雞和兔子的總數(shù)”
scanf(%D“,&A)
if(A>=0)
{
printf(”n請(qǐng)輸入總數(shù)雞和兔子的腳數(shù)“
scanf(%d”,&B)
如果(B%2==1)
printf(”腳數(shù)是奇數(shù),這很奇怪!“
else if(b=a*2)
{
C=(4*a-b)/2//雞的數(shù)量
d=a-C//兔子的數(shù)量
if(C*2d*4==b)
printf(”有%LD只雞n只兔子n“,C,d)//C和d顛倒了
else
printf(”這真的很難,計(jì)算機(jī)無法計(jì)算!n“”
}]else
printf(”雞和兔腳的數(shù)字范圍不正確,正確的范圍是%D--%D!n“,a*2,a*4)
}
Else
printf(”數(shù)量不能為負(fù)!n “)]}